E. Replacement of Topsoil: <br /> 1. After backfilling, grade and finish areas to receive topsoil, allowing for the <br /> specified depth of top soil replacement. <br /> 2. Replace the topsoil and smoothly spread the material with a minimum of <br /> compaction. <br /> 3. Finish areas covered with topsoil to blend into the finished topography <br /> with respect to the proper grade, contour and cross section. Rough grade <br /> replaced top soil to 2 to 4 inches higher than final elevations to allow for <br /> settlement. <br /> 4. Bring the surface to a condition ready for planting operations. <br /> SECTION 02210 — CONTROLLED LOW STRENGTH MATERIAL <br /> PART 1 - GENERAL <br /> 1.01 THE REQUIREMENT <br /> The Contractor shall provide Controlled Low Strength Material (CLSM), complete and in place, <br /> in accordance with the Contract Documents. <br /> 1.02 SUBMITTALS <br /> A. CLSM mix designs which show the proportions and gradations of all materials <br /> proposed for each type of CLSM indicated. Each mix design shall be <br /> accompanied by independent laboratory test results of the indicated properties. <br /> B. All testing will be done by a testing laboratory selected by the City, except as <br /> otherwise indicated. <br /> 1.03 QUALITY ASSURANCE <br /> A. The Contractor shall perform a field correlation test for each mix of CLSM used in <br /> pipe zone, trench zone, or backfill used in amounts greater than 100 cubic yards <br /> or when CLSM is required to support traffic or other live loads on the fill less than <br /> 7 days after placing CLSM. <br /> B. Field correlation tests shall be performed in a test pit similar in cross section to <br /> the work and at least 10-feet long at a location near the work. The proposed <br /> location shall be acceptable to the Engineer. <br /> C. Laboratory and field tests shall be performed on samples taken from the same <br /> CLSM batch mix. All tests shall be performed by a laboratory at the Contractor's <br /> expense. <br /> D. Testing shall be performed once each 2-hours during the first 8 hours, once each <br /> 8-hours during the first week, and once each 24-hours until the CLSM mix <br /> reaches the maximum design strength. <br /> July 2007 Division III-62 NEI Phase II Water and Sewer <br /> CIP Nos. 7468, 7589, 7590 <br />
